Altstadt Grossbasel

Step into Basel's Altstadt Grossbasel, a medieval treasure where cobblestone streets wind past colourful Renaissance buildings. The towering Basel Minster cathedral overlooks lively Marktplatz, where market stalls gather beneath the ornate red Town Hall. This car-free district makes exploring the city's rich history a pleasure on foot. Art enthusiasts will find paradise in the neighborhood's exceptional museums. The Kunstmuseum Basel and Basel Historical Museum showcase centuries of cultural heritage. Traditional Swiss restaurants serve authentic fondue in historic guild houses, while boutique shops offer local crafts and chocolates.

Kleinbasel

Across the Rhine from Basel's Old Town, Kleinbasel offers a refreshing mix of multicultural charm and riverside beauty. The cobblestone streets wind past colourful buildings where locals outnumber tourists. Summer brings swimmers to the Rhine's clean waters while traditional wooden ferries glide silently between banks. Discover art at Museum Tinguely or browse independent boutiques along Klybeckstrasse. Diverse restaurants serve everything from Swiss rösti to Turkish döner at area prices. Excellent tram connections make exploring easy, but the peaceful riverfront promenades invite you to slow down.

Sankt Alban

Sankt Alban whispers tales of medieval Basel through its iconic gate and ancient paper mills. Narrow cobblestone streets wind between historic buildings, revealing centuries of stories. The peaceful Rhine promenade offers scenic walks with views of historic bridges and glittering waters. This upscale residential haven balances preserved history with authentic Swiss living. Elegant homes and local cafés provide glimpses into Basel's refined character. Excellent tram connections make exploring the wider city remarkably simple.

Clara

Clara blends multicultural charm with residential tranquility just minutes from Basel's city centre. Locals shop at area markets while children play in tree-lined streets. This welcoming district offers an authentic glimpse into everyday Swiss life away from tourist crowds. The area sits near Badischer Bahnhof railway station with excellent tram connections throughout the city. Discover family-run restaurants serving diverse cuisines that reflect the area's cultural mix. Clara's quiet evenings and modest parks create a peaceful retreat after exploring Basel's livelier districts.

Basel City Centre

Basel City Centre blends medieval charm with cultural richness across its pedestrian-friendly streets. The 12th-century Basel Minster cathedral stands majestically among historic buildings and lively squares. Cobblestone pathways lead to hidden treasures throughout this artistic hub. World-class museums like the Kunstmuseum showcase impressive collections in this Swiss cultural capital. Hop on frequent trams at Marktplatz or University stops for easy exploration. The flowing Rhine adds natural beauty to this walkable district filled with Swiss heritage.

Nestled where three countries meet, Basel's world-class art museums showcase masterpieces from Picasso to Holbein in renovated medieval buildings. Explore the Rhine River's banks where locals swim with waterproof bags in summer, then visit Fondation Beyeler in Riehen for its remarkable modern art collection.

  • Basel Town Hall: This historic civic building boasts striking red façades and intricate frescoes, embodying the rich cultural heritage of Basel. Visitors can explore its charming courtyards and admire the impressive architecture that dates back to the 14th century.
  • Basler Muenster: A stunning example of Gothic architecture, this cathedral features magnificent stained glass windows and a panoramic view of the Rhine River from its towers. The serene atmosphere invites reflection and appreciation of its historical significance.
  • Basel Art Museum: Renowned for its extensive collection of modern art, this museum showcases works from the 14th century to contemporary pieces. The thoughtfully curated exhibitions provide a glimpse into the evolution of artistic expression.

Best time to go to Basel

The best time to visit Basel is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ather like in Basel?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Basel is 986 mm.
